Ukraine rejects President of France Emmanuel Macron’s proposal for a European political community for nations that are not formal members of the European Union.
According to the source, Zelensky stated this in an interview with the Dutch news site Nieuwsuur.
Answering a journalist’s query on whether or not it’s appropriate to use “Macron presented a “alternative to EU membership,” to which he replied, “No, I don’t think [it’s acceptable]… It isn’t required. We simply require assistance from these countries; we do not desire an alternative.”
He went on to say that such an endeavour echoed Dutch Prime Minister Mark Rutte’s and German Chancellor Olaf Scholz’s suggestions.
“I believe they each have their own set of preconceptions regarding this. We don’t require that “The President came to an end.
As previously reported, President of France Emmanuel Macron announced on May 9 his effort to establish a new “European political community” allowing nations that are not formal members of the EU to join. He also mentioned Ukraine.
